Achieving Planned Innovation A Proven System for Creating Successful New Products and Services Frank R. Bacon, Jr. and Thomas W. Butler, Jr.

info Details

The Planned Innovation (PI) system allows any firm, of any size, in any country in the world to achieve high rates of success in new-product innovation. PI is a disciplined and practical step-by-step sequence of procedures for reaching the intended destination point -- successful products. This program features 5 steps to success: a disciplined reasoning process; lasting market orientation; proper selection criteria; scientific reasoning to determine requirements before making major expenditures; and proper organizational staffing. Explains what to do and why in evaluating the potential of any new product or service that you want to introduce into the marketplace.
